Subject: Quickstore 4.2 — bloom filter now fronts the KV layer

Plugin authors: starting with this release, Quickstore places a bloom filter ahead of the key-value store. Negative lookups return faster; false positives fall through safely. No API changes are required on your side. Verify your plugin against the staging build referenced below.

session token of fahif-tadup = htk3_9c7

The FeeForge rules engine, which computes shipping fees for Marlowe Mercantile checkouts, is intermittently failing to reach its rules database since the 14:20 deploy. Symptoms: pool acquisition timeouts every few minutes, fee evaluation falling back to cached rules. Restarting the service clears it for roughly an hour. Suspect a leaked connection in the new tier-lookup path. On-call: please enable pool tracing and capture a leak report. Use the staging database via the connection string below.

replica DSN, kagaf-kajef: postgresql://eliius_svc:UA@db-a408.paliqnet.internal:5432/istys

## Deployment

We traced the nightly job drift on Larkspur to a stale NTP peer on the batch pool. If cron fires late by more than 90s, restart `larkd` and check the scheduler lag gauge before paging anyone else. Do not bump the retry window; that masks the drift. The daemon currently ships with these deployment values.

settings of yaguf-fajof:
[druvan]
host = druvan.plorvatech.example
user = druvan_svc
database = druvan_prod

Release checklist — flaky DNS item

Owner: Merl. Intermittent DNS resolution failures from the Quillhost edge nodes to the internal registry resurfaced twice this week. Resolver cache TTL was dropped to 30s as a stopgap; failure rate down but not zero. Do not ship until the retry wrapper is verified in staging. Weekly sync: confirm Merl's fix is in the cut. Record the candidate build against the token below.

pipeline stamp: htk6_7941f2

## Onboarding — Snapshot Testing

UI components in the Plumeline design system are snapshot-tested on every pull request. Regenerate snapshots locally with the `plume snap` command and commit the diffs. Approved snapshot bundles are signed before merging so CI can trust them. Configure your local signer with the key below.

deploy key for kahof-tadup: bky4_rRMZ